The crush to get backstage afterward was worse than ever \u2014 so intense that some editors started filming the melee, lest a human stampede ensue. The collection was also messy, intentionally so \u2014 many of the clothes decayed, ravaged, fraying and purposely soiled, and then layered up in seemingly haphazard ways. Fifteen models stormed through the vast, carpeted space at a furious pace, returning three more times with layers of clothing removed or added, so you discovered that a flaring skirt was actually a \u201950s-inflected dress, or that there were cotton drawers and a gray sweater sheltered under a trim black pantsuit. Miuccia Prada and Raf Simons reprised many silhouettes and fabrics from their fall men\u2019s shows, notably tubular dress coats; wrinkled shirts with dangling and demonstrative French cuffs; crinkled trenchcoats peeling away at the seams to reveal checkered wool underneath, and little utility capelets in bright cotton, here with vertical strips of animal-print fluff attached to the plackets. New layers included sensational skirts and shift dresses where corroded black wool yielded to blurred floral prints. As a foil to all that imperfection were hyper-luxurious accessories: petite bucket and top-handle bags in polished alligator, and tall, lace-up boots dangling beaded gewgaws, or completely paved in feathers. Once you fought your way past security to the sweaty scrum around Simons and Prada, the latter was explaining that the layering and un-layering was to express \u201cthe continuous necessity of change\u201d and how a woman navigates them and reflects them with her clothes. The show space evoked a hollowed-out mansion \u2014 with\u00a0fancy moldings, colonial windows and marble fireplaces still clinging to the outer walls \u2014 and was repurposed from the men\u2019s show, with the addition of paintings and furniture from across five centuries \u2014 yet more layers, of culture, history and meaning.
